Fireticks, like all vanilla based damage, cause an invuln period of about 0.5 seconds. During that time, you cannot be attacked by any vanilla based damage. While this is mostly irrelevant information for most casters, as they deal purely in Hero-based spell damage, the Pyromancer is an exception. He is considered melee, and does a very large amount of melee damage. Melee damage is vanilla, and therefore subject to the invulnerability period.

The more fire-ticks present on Pyromancer abilities, the less he will be able to melee his targets. Between ChaosOrb and DarkBolt (Withering), he is already being inhibited by vanilla invuln periods, and adding any more would only serve to reduce his effectiveness in melee combat.
